Understanding PPC Advertising Services

PPC (Pay-Per-Click) advertising services are an essential component of digital marketing strategies that allow businesses to reach their target audience effectively. By paying for clicks on their ads, companies can drive traffic to their websites and generate leads. This model provides measurable results and a cost-effective way to enhance online visibility.PPC campaigns consist of several key components that work together to ensure their success.

These components include research, ad creation, landing page optimization, and performance tracking. Each element plays a vital role in determining the effectiveness of the campaign and achieving the desired business objectives.

Key Components of PPC Campaigns

The effectiveness of a PPC campaign relies heavily on its core components, which include:

  • Research: The foundation of any PPC campaign lies in selecting the right s that potential customers are likely to use in their search queries. Effective research helps in targeting the right audience and optimizing ad placements.
  • Ad Creation: Crafting compelling ad copy is crucial for attracting clicks. Ad content must be relevant, engaging, and aligned with the s chosen, providing a clear value proposition to entice users.
  • Landing Page Optimization: Once users click on an ad, they should be directed to a landing page that is optimized for conversions. This involves ensuring that the page is user-friendly, loads quickly, and contains relevant content that matches the ad’s promise.
  • Performance Tracking: Analyzing campaign performance through metrics such as click-through rate (CTR), conversion rate, and return on ad spend (ROAS) is essential. This tracking allows businesses to make data-driven adjustments to improve effectiveness.

Types of PPC Advertising Services

PPC advertising encompasses various formats tailored to meet the diverse needs of businesses across multiple industries. By understanding different types of PPC advertising services, organizations can effectively choose the most suitable options to achieve their marketing objectives. This section will delve into the primary types of PPC services available and their specific applications.

Search Ads

Search ads are text-based advertisements displayed on search engine results pages (SERPs) when users enter specific queries. They are typically characterized by their pay-per-click model, meaning advertisers only pay when someone clicks on their ad. This format is particularly effective for capturing intent-driven traffic, as users are actively searching for products or services.

Display Ads

Display ads utilize visual elements such as images and animations to attract attention across various websites and platforms within a display network. These ads can be strategically placed on websites that align with the target audience’s interests and demographics, making them an excellent choice for brand awareness campaigns and retargeting efforts.

Video Ads

Video ads, often featured on platforms like YouTube, provide immersive storytelling opportunities. They can range from short clips to longer-form content, allowing brands to engage viewers effectively. Video ads are especially beneficial for industries looking to showcase products in action, such as technology, beauty, and automotive sectors.

Shopping Ads

Shopping ads are designed specifically for e-commerce businesses, showcasing product images, prices, and descriptions directly in the search results. These ads drive qualified traffic to online stores and are proven to enhance conversions, particularly for retail businesses.

Social Media Ads

Social media platforms offer various PPC advertising formats, including sponsored posts, story ads, and carousel ads. These platforms allow businesses to leverage targeting capabilities based on user behavior, interests, and demographics, making them ideal for industries such as fashion, hospitality, and entertainment.

Native Ads

Native ads are designed to seamlessly blend with the content of the website they’re displayed on, providing a less intrusive experience for users. This format can be particularly effective for content marketing and building brand awareness, appealing to industries focused on storytelling and education.

Overview of Popular PPC Advertising Platforms

Several key platforms dominate the PPC advertising landscape, each offering distinct features that cater to different marketing needs. The most recognized platforms include Google Ads and Bing Ads. Below is a detailed examination of these platforms, highlighting their unique features and how to utilize them effectively.

Google Ads

Google Ads is the largest and most widely used PPC platform, providing advertisers with access to an extensive network of search results and display advertising.

  • Search Network: Google Ads allows advertisers to display ads on the Google search engine results pages (SERPs) when users search for specific s, ensuring high visibility.
  • Display Network: With millions of websites partaking in the Google Display Network, advertisers can run visual banner ads that reach users as they browse various online platforms.
  • Advanced Targeting Options: Google Ads offers robust targeting capabilities, including demographic targeting, location targeting, and retargeting, allowing for precise audience reach.
  • Ad Extensions: Advertisers can enhance their ads with additional information like phone numbers, site links, and reviews, which can improve click-through rates (CTR) and overall performance.

Utilizing Google Ads effectively requires continuous monitoring and adjustments to align with changing market dynamics and user behavior.

Bing Ads

Bing Ads (now known as Microsoft Advertising) is another significant PPC platform, providing an alternative for advertisers looking to reach a different segment of the audience.

  • Lower Competition: Bing Ads typically features lower competition for s compared to Google Ads, which can result in a lower cost-per-click (CPC) for advertisers.
  • Demographic Differences: The user demographic on Bing tends to be older and more affluent, making it a suitable platform for businesses targeting these populations.
  • Integration with Microsoft Ecosystem: Bing Ads integrates seamlessly with Microsoft’s services, including LinkedIn, which can enhance audience targeting based on professional attributes.
  • Importing Campaigns: Ease of importing Google Ads campaigns into Bing Ads allows advertisers to streamline their efforts and maintain consistency across platforms.

Maximizing the effectiveness of Bing Ads involves leveraging its unique user base and lower CPC opportunities to reach targeted audiences efficiently.

Establishing a Budget for PPC Advertising Services

Creating a budget for PPC advertising starts with identifying your overall marketing goals and the specific objectives you aim to achieve with your campaigns. This involves assessing factors such as your target audience, industry benchmarks, and previous performance metrics. Key considerations for establishing your budget include:

  • Setting Clear Goals: Define what you want to achieve, be it brand awareness, lead generation, or sales conversion.
  • Understanding Costs: Analyze the cost per click (CPC) in your industry and set a daily or monthly budget based on these insights.
  • Monitoring Performance: Regularly review your campaigns to adjust your budget according to what is performing well.

For instance, if your goal is to acquire 100 leads at a cost of $20 each, your budget would need to be set to at least $2,000, assuming all leads convert at the same rate.

Bidding Strategies and Their Implications

Bidding strategies play a vital role in how your budget is utilized and can significantly affect your campaign performance. Different methods of bidding can lead to different outcomes, depending on your objectives and market conditions. The primary bidding strategies include:

  • Manual CPC: Advertisers set their own maximum cost per click for ads. This allows for greater control but requires constant monitoring.
  • Enhanced CPC: An automated strategy that adjusts your manual bids based on the likelihood of conversion, optimizing your spend.
  • Target CPA (Cost per Acquisition): Sets bids to help get as many conversions as possible at the desired cost per acquisition.
  • Maximize Conversions: An automated strategy that focuses on getting the most conversions within your budget.

Implementing the right bidding strategy can lead to improved visibility and efficiency in ad spend. For example, a company employing Target CPA might find that their cost per acquisition decreases significantly as the algorithm optimizes bids for the best performing segments.

Key Performance Indicators for PPC Campaigns

The effectiveness of PPC campaigns can be evaluated through specific KPIs that provide insights into performance. Monitoring these indicators is essential for informed decision-making. The following KPIs are critical for assessing PPC success:

  • Click-Through Rate (CTR): This metric measures the percentage of users who click on the ad after seeing it. A higher CTR indicates effective ad copy and targeting.
  • Conversion Rate: This KPI tracks the percentage of users who complete a desired action after clicking the ad. It reflects the quality of the landing page and the ad’s relevance.
  • Cost Per Click (CPC): CPC shows the average amount spent for each click on the ad. It helps in budgeting and understanding the cost-effectiveness of the campaign.
  • Return on Ad Spend (ROAS): This metric calculates the revenue generated for every dollar spent on advertising, providing a clear picture of campaign profitability.
  • Quality Score: A rating from Google that assesses the quality and relevance of ads, s, and landing pages. Higher scores can lead to lower CPCs and better ad placements.

Strategies for Improving PPC Campaign Performance

Several strategies can be employed to enhance the performance of PPC campaigns over time. These strategies are designed to address key aspects of the campaign, thereby ensuring optimal results.

  • Refinement: Regularly reviewing and updating the list of targeted s can significantly impact campaign performance. Identifying high-performing s and eliminating underperforming ones allows for better ad relevance and improved Quality Scores.
  • Ad Copy Enhancement: Crafting compelling ad copy that resonates with the target audience is essential. Testing different messaging and value propositions can lead to higher CTRs and conversion rates.
  • Landing Page Optimization: Ensuring that landing pages are optimized for user experience and relevance to the ad can improve conversion rates. This includes fast loading times, mobile responsiveness, and clear calls to action.
  • Negative s: Implementing a strategy to identify and add negative s can help prevent ads from showing in irrelevant searches, saving budget and increasing campaign efficiency.
  • Ad Extensions Utilization: Utilizing ad extensions such as site links, callouts, and structured snippets can enhance the visibility of ads and provide additional information to potential customers.

Avoiding Common Pitfalls in PPC Advertising

Despite the potential benefits of PPC advertising, several common pitfalls can hinder campaign success. Recognizing and avoiding these pitfalls is critical for achieving desired outcomes.

  • Neglecting Regular Monitoring: Failing to monitor campaigns regularly can lead to missed opportunities for optimization. Continuous analysis is necessary to adjust strategies as market conditions and consumer behaviors change.
  • Overlooking Mobile Optimization: With the increasing use of mobile devices for searches, ads that are not optimized for mobile can result in poor performance. Ensuring that ads and landing pages are mobile-friendly is essential.
  • Ignoring Conversion Tracking: Not implementing conversion tracking can lead to a lack of insight into which ads are driving results. Setting up tracking mechanisms is crucial for evaluating campaign success.
  • Budget Mismanagement: Ineffectively allocating budgets across campaigns or failing to adjust bids based on performance can waste resources. A strategic approach to budgeting is necessary for maximizing returns.

By being aware of these pitfalls and actively working to mitigate them, businesses can significantly enhance the effectiveness of their PPC advertising efforts.
